Windows XP SP3

I have downloaded MS Resource Kit and trying to burn a bootable cd of your
WINDIAG software, which is satisfactorily working on a floppy disk.

When I try to burn a bootable cd of the MS software windiag.exe, which
works satisfactorily on a floppy disk I get the following error: Error
verifying ISO image.

My entry in the Command Shell is as follows:

cdburn.exe h: a:\windiag, where h: is the CD drive

Could you help me please?
 
J

John

cdburn.exe is only design to burn a iso image to a cd disc. cdburn.exe cannot
burn the contents that is on your floppy to a cd disc.

What you need is Nero or Roxio software that is able to burn a bootable dos
disk.

or

You can download Windiag from http://oca.microsoft.com/en/windiag.asp which
gives you the option to create a Windiag on floppy or cd disc.
